1. Mastering Frame and Posture

One of the most important aspects of ballroom dancing is maintaining a strong frame and posture. This not only helps you look more elegant and confident, but it also allows you to move more smoothly and effortlessly across the dance floor. To improve your frame and posture, focus on the following:

  • Standing tall with your chest lifted and shoulders back
  • Engaging your core muscles to provide stability and support
  • Keeping your head up and eyes forward to project confidence
  • Maintaining a relaxed and natural grip on your partner

2. Developing Fluidity and Smoothness

Ballroom dancing is all about flowing gracefully across the dance floor, and developing fluidity and smoothness in your movements is key to achieving this. To improve your fluidity and smoothness, focus on the following:

  • Moving from the center of your body, using your core muscles to initiate and control your movements
  • Maintaining a steady and even tempo throughout your dance
  • Using your knees and ankles to absorb and release energy as you move
  • Practicing good footwork and staying in contact with the floor at all times

3. Adding Expression and Emotion

Ballroom dancing is not just about technique and precision, it's also about conveying emotion and telling a story through your movements. To add expression and emotion to your dance, focus on the following:

  • Using your facial expressions to convey the mood and emotion of the dance
  • Connecting with your partner and responding to their movements and energy
  • Adding musicality and phrasing to your movements, using the rhythm and melody of the music to guide your steps
  • Practicing good breath control and using your breath to enhance your movements and add fluidity
